Motor Sports - Cars & Bikes

Find Your Offroad Adventure

Motocross and mountain bike enthusiasts will find San Diego’s many offroad dirt trails inviting, with the added bonus of an on-road option through Balboa Park or the Mission Beach Boardwalk.

On weekends and holidays, and practically any other day of the year, the barren sand dunes of Ocotillo Wells State Vehicular Recreation Area are alive with the buzz of high-revving engines and low-torquing gears. Motocross superstars like Brian Deegan, Mike Metzger and Jeremy McGrath can be found jumping gaps and throwing down stunts like Indian Airs, backflips and no-handed Heart Attacks, while amateur enthusiasts on dirt bikes, ATVs, and dune buggies put their rigs through the paces and party hearty in the campground.

Desert Trails

For those more interested in breaking ground than busting their kidneys, the Anza-Borrego Desert State Park offers more than 600,000 acres and 100 miles of offroad tracks and trails, leading to badlands and box canyons, Indian petroglyphs and abandoned settlements, refreshing oases and hidden hot springs. There are fire roads in the local mountains, but most of them traverse private lands and protected parks so access can be restricting. If the San Diego scene doesn't satisfy your appetite for offroad adventure, look south to Baja California - 1000 miles of bone-jarring, four-wheelin' fun.

Biking and BMX

Mountain bike enthusiasts will find San Diego's many offroad dirt trails inviting, with the added bonus of the on-road option to take a spin through Balboa Park or a cruise down the Mission Beach Boardwalk. Popular urban assaults include the serpentine singletrack of Tecolote Canyon, the steeps of Iron Mountain, and riding on the Silver Strand beach at low tide. Up in the hills around Cuyamaca, Palomar and Mount Laguna are mixed-use hiking trails that offer longer and more challenging trips. BMXers should check out the Kearny Moto Park, with its super-size tabletops and gap jumps.
